Runs a Northern New England community-bank franchise built around Camden National Bank, taking deposits and making consumer, municipal, nonprofit, institutional, and commercial loans through one banking and related financial-services segment.
Alongside branch banking, the platform offers wealth management and trust services, brokerage, investment advisory, insurance, mortgage banking, treasury management, and digital tools such as MortgageTouch, BusinessTouch, and TreasuryLink. The footprint is concentrated in Maine and New Hampshire after the Northway merger, with select Massachusetts activity.
Relationship banking, local decision-making, digital delivery, and customer service define the operating model. Earnings depend heavily on spread banking, so interest rates, deposit costs, credit demand, and competition from banks, credit unions, fintechs, lenders, brokers, and advisors shape the business.
